Marin have given their venerable Rift Zone trail bike an update and launch a four model range based around an all-alloy frame.
Marin launched the alloy version of the new Rift Zone this week, with the now obligatory frame, kinematic and geometry tweaks.
This bike was influenced heavily by Marin’s athletes, retaining the good from the outgoing model and improving on what wasn’t so great. For starters you get the Series 3 alloy frame that has new tubes and forgings, and crucially, clips seat tubes across the board. Braze-in cable entry and exits aim to produce a rattle and zip tie free setup.
Travel has grown to make the bike more capable too. 10mm on the front and 5mm on the rear may not sound like much but there’s also changes to the kinematics that use that travel differently.
The range been made with a focus on bang for your buck, with the XR model topping the range at under three grand, there’s no bikes here that you could swap for a very nice new van or second hand Porsche Boxster.
The Rift Zone Range is four bike strong, kicking off with the Rift Zone 1 at £1,655.00, rising to the Rift Zone XR seen here at £3,095.00 RRP. There’s also a kids’ Rift Zone at £1,675.00 too. All three models of the new Rift Zone are available in 27.5 or 29″ wheels, but with no Mullet option. There is a 26″/Junior (24″) option too.
Geometry
The Rift Zone is available in Small, Medium, Large and XLarge.
Reach on the Medium is 460mm with a seat tube of 400mm. Head angle is 65.5 degrees with a seta angle of 77 degrees. Chainstays are 430mm across the sizes with a wheelbase on the medium of 1205.1mm.
2023 Marin Rift Zone models
2023 Marin Rift Zone 1

Key features:
- X-Fusion Slide Boost RC 140mm fork
- X-Fusion O2 Pro R shock
- Shimano Deore 11-speed drive
- Shimano MT200 2-piston brakes
- Shimano MT hubs on Marin alloy rims
- Marin alloy seatpost
- £1,655.00 RRP
2023 Marin Rift Zone 2

Key features:
- Marzocchi Bomber Z2 140mm fork
- RockShox Deluxe Select RT shock
- Shimano Deore 12-speed drive
- Shimano MT200 2-piston brakes
- Shimano MT401 hubs on Marin alloy wheels
- TranzX dropper
- £2,155.00 RRP
2023 Marin Rift Zone XR

Key features:
- Marzocchi Bomber Z1 140mm fork
- Fox Float X Performance shock
- Shimano SLX/XT 12-speed drive
- Shimano MT420 4-piston brakes
- Marin alloy wheels
- X-Fusion Manic dropper
- £3,095.00 RRP
2023 Marin Rift Zone 26″/Jr

Key features:
- X-Fusion Velvet RLC 130mm fork
- X-Fusion O2 Pro R shock
- Shimano Deore 11-speed drive
- Shimano MT201 2-piston brakes
- Marin alloy wheels
- Marin alloy seat post
- £1,675.00 RRP
